「Temp」学习进度

发布时间 2023-09-10 12:59:26作者: Eon_Sky

状态:

  • ✔️:掌握的知识点。
  • ⭕:学过但不熟练的知识点。
  • ❌:没学过的知识点。

搜索

算法 状态
DFS ✔️
BFS ✔️
记忆化 ✔️
双向搜索
A*
IDA*
DLX

动态规划

算法 状态
线性 DP ✔️
背包 ✔️
区间 DP ✔️
树形 DP ✔️
状压 DP ✔️
单调队列优化 DP ✔️
斜率优化 DP ✔️
四边形不等式优化 DP

字符串

算法 状态
哈希 ✔️
KMP
Trie 树 ✔️
ACAM ✔️
Manacher
SA
SAM
PAM
后缀树

数学

算法 状态
gcd ✔️
exgcd
欧拉函数
数论分块 ✔️
线性筛 ✔️
类欧几里得算法
费马小定理 ✔️
欧拉定理
逆元 ✔️
线同余方程
中国剩余定理
排列组合 ✔️
卡特兰数
斯特林数
矩阵
高斯消元
线性基
FFT
NTT
狄利克雷卷积
莫比乌斯反演
杜教筛
拉格朗日插值
牛顿迭代法

数据结构

算法 状态
ST 表 ✔️
树状数组 ✔️
线段树 ✔️
分块 ✔️
可并堆
主席树 ✔️
平衡树
树链剖分 ✔️
树套树
LCT
K-D Tree
珂朵莉树
李超线段树
可持久化数据结构

图论

算法 状态
最短路 ✔️
树的直径 ✔️
树的重心 ✔️
LCA ✔️
启发式合并
虚树
树分治
动态树分治
生成树 ✔️
拓扑排序 ✔️
差分约束 ✔️
Tarjan ✔️
二分图
2-SAT
矩阵树定理
最大流 ✔️
费用流 ✔️
无汇源上下界网络流

杂项

算法 状态
CDQ ✔️
莫队 ✔️
整体二分
分数规划
爬山算法
模拟退火